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q: Do I require a membership like iFit or Zwift to use a home treadmill?
A: No. While lots of contemporary treadmills feature big screens created for interactive app subscriptions, nearly all of them can be utilized in "manual mode" without paying a monthly cost. You can simply step on, press start, and by hand adjust your speed and slope.
Q: How much area do I require to leave around a treadmill?
A: For security reasons, makers normally suggest leaving a minimum of 2 metres of clearance behind the treadmill and 0.5 metres on either side. This ensures that if you slip or stumble, you have a safe zone to clear the moving belt.
Q: Are home treadmills costly to run on my electrical energy costs?
A: treadmills sale do take in electricity, but normally not as much as cooking area devices like ovens or kettles. A standard home treadmill uses in between 600 to 1500 watts depending on your speed and weight load. Running a treadmill for 30 minutes a day generally includes just a modest total up to a regular monthly UK energy expense (usually in between ₤ 3 to ₤ 6 a month, depending upon current energy tariff caps).
Q: Can I put a treadmill on an upstairs wooden flooring?
A: Yes, but bear in mind that vibrations and foot-thumping sound can take a trip through ceilings to spaces listed below. To safeguard your floorings and keep downstairs next-door neighbors or member of the family delighted, always buy a thick, high-density rubber treadmill mat to position underneath the unit.
